    I see a lot of blogs with the "Subscribe to my feed" where you type in your email, and hit go and then it sends them to your feedburner. Is there a widget/plugin for this? I would like to do this on my blog.

    I know this is a newbie question, I have traffic and a normal set of readers. I just figured i should capitalize on this like other blogs are doing. I didn't see anything I could use directly on feedburner's site.

    Ok, so I figured it out. It's quite simple and just required opening my eyes and actually looking.

    Basically, go to your feed in feedburner. Find the "Publicize" tab and click it. Next, find the "Email Subscriptions" link the left sidebar (the 4th choice from the top). This will give you the code which you can copy and paste into your sidebar, and change to your liking.
